History - This house was built by the Coolidge Family some time in the mid-teens or twenties. Charles Coolidge (the World War II war hero for whom Coolidge Park was named) spent his early childhood in this house. The fixtures in the living room, den, and upstairs hallway are original to the house. All of the built-ins and most of the floors, woodwork, and windows, with their beautiful wavy glass, are original as well.
